Sofitel Paris Le Faubourg (Paris, Île-de-France) 7 Hotel Reviews | Tablet Hotels

"Sofitel Paris Le Faubourg comprises two landmark buildings on rue Boissy d’Anglas, close to the Place de la Concorde — one of them previously the headquarters of the Marie Claire magazines, the other an 18th-century private mansion. The location is fantastic, adjacent to the US embassy and quite near the Louvre and Orsay museums, as well as Cartier and Hermes. Buddha Bar is just across the street, and Hotel de Crillon is also nearby." - Tablet Hotels

Booked this hotel through Costco travel and was very happy with the selection. It was centrally located. The hotel was located about .7 miles from the Louvre and the Opera House. It was a quick 3 minute walk to Concorde metro station and one Metro stop from Invalides station. This gave access is easy access to the Metro and RER C rail. The RER C was important because we wanted to see the Palace of Versailles. The staff and facilities was great. They were friendly, spoke English, and answered all our questions. The bathrooms were spacious, clean and good water pressure. My family particularly loved the library that had chess and checkers to play on. Good way to keep the kids entertained while we make plans for the day. The morning buffet was great with tons of selections including a wide selection of pastries, yogurts, juices and meats. The even had a well made congee. It was my wife's favorite as it was both savory and spicy. If you like high end shopping then nothing could be better. Every major chain was represented in the neighborhood. The security was a whole other level. Sharing the street with the embassy meant arm guards at either end of the street and stationed guards that seem to take their breaks in the hotel. Patrols of armed guards could be seen walking the area. My only complaint was the lack of local food shops / restaurants. The food that was in walking distance was lacking in both diversity and quality. However, this can be fixed by hoping on the metro. Overall, the hotel was a great base of operations for exploring Paris and I highly recommend it.

Obviously one can't expect Mandarin Oriental-level service, but everyone was polite and friendly. It's nice and quiet in all the rooms, because the Rue Boissy d'Anglais is not open to through traffic (taxis can enter to drop off passengers at the hotel). The rooms not facing the street are arranged around an inner courtyard which serves as a sort of patio for the hotel's dining area. Decor in the older rooms & suites is pretty traditional: damask wallcoverings, generic hotel furnishings. The pricier Didier Gomez-designed suites are much more contemporary in design (think urban loft type furnishings). I would recommend staying in a junior suite or better; the regular rooms would be a little too cramped for my taste - plus, you don't get the Hermès toiletries in the regular rooms! Beds have high quality linens and are quite comfortable; I'm a picky sleeper because I've always had chronic back problems. There is high-speed internet, but remember to bring travel adapters if necessary; the hotel has some, but they sometimes don't have enough to go around. In-room dining and the hotel restaurant are reliably good, though not mind-blowing. Lovely breakfast offering which can sometimes get busy, so if you don't like to wait, you may want to book the night before. Room service only runs until 11pm-ish, IIRC. Really, though, the real beauty of this particular hotel is the killer, killer location. 1 block to the Place de la Concorde & the Ave. des Champs-Élysées, 2-3 blocks to Rue Cambon and literally steps away from the HERMÈS mothership & the rest of rue du Faubourg Saint-Honoré
